Results for 'tūkino'

tūkino - abuse; wicked

Tūkino. 1. v.t. Ill-treat, use with violence.

2. a. Distressed, in trouble. E koro tukino, e koro mate i te whakatoitoi (M. 159).

Williams Dictionary

I tūkino he tangata i tēnei tamaiti.
A man abused this child.
